    Nanocellulose Crystal Nanocellulose is Cellulose material with nano size Therefore, it has special properties in various fields that are useful in food and cosmetics.

    Application in food:

    Texture enhancer and stabilizer: Nanocellulose can be used as a natural texture enhancer and stabilizer in food products. It can help improve the texture, viscosity, and stability of sauces, salad dressings, and other liquid foods.

    Fat replacement and calorie reduction: Same as microcrystalline cellulose. Nanocellulose can act as a fat substitute in low-fat or low-calorie foods. It can help maintain the desired mouthfeel and texture while reducing the overall fat content of the product.

    Film Coating : Films and coatings made from nanocellulose can be applied to fruits and vegetables to extend their shelf life by creating a barrier against moisture and gases.

    Application in cosmetics:

    Stabilization of emulsions: Nanocellulose can stabilize emulsions in cosmetic products. Helps prevent separation of water and oil ingredients. This is useful in products such as creams, lotions, and serums.

    Thickening agent and texture enhancer: Nanocellulose can act as a thickener to improve the texture and consistency of cosmetic formulas. It can give a soft and luxurious feel to products such as moisturizers and body creams.

    Delivery of active ingredients: Cellulose nanoparticles can encapsulate and deliver active ingredients to the skin. Increase efficiency and deliver on target This is especially useful in products like serums and treatments.

    Sunscreen Formulations: Nanocellulose can be used to improve the dispersion of sunscreens in cosmetic products. Leads to more consistent and effective sun protection.

    Usage: emulsion stabilizer

    How to mix: Blend or stir until dissolved in water.

    Usage rate: 0.1-2%

    Product appearance: slightly viscous liquid

    Solubility: can be dispersed in water

    Storage: Can be stored at room temperature. But close the bottle cap tightly. Then completely protected from sunlight or heat. The product has a minimum shelf life of 2 years.

    INCI Name : Cellulose
